5459.0. "software logic error" by CGOOA::KUHNEN () Tue Aug 10 1993 16:44
I upgraded to v.13 about a month ago. After the upgrade I had problems
with data which had been recorded by background processes, and to get
the recording to work without error I had to delete my old files and let
the background create new files. Recording now seems to work without
problem. Whenever I check the recorded data all now seems well.
However when I look at the data using a command such as :
SHOW SNMP RED_WATER_WELLFLEET INTERFACE 1 TOTAL UTILIZATION, -
FOR START = 1-JUL-1993:00:00 EVERY 01:00:00 UNTIL 15-JUL-1993:00:00 ,-
IN DOMAIN RECORD
I will occassionally get a "software logic error detected" and the
command will fail. If I retry the command it may work on the second try
or fail again. It is inconsistent. The data require all seems to be
available. Is this a know bug?
The other problem I have is that I now on many occassions get
attribute not available returned by the above command line. I guess
that this means that it is unable to find the line speed or some other
required information required by the FM to perform the calculation. I
am recording all partitions using the default parameters in regards to
frequency of polling. Should I be polling more often ? Since most of
these parameters would be unlikely to change should the PA not be able
to use a previous entry if the entry for the requested time frame is
unavailable.
